Gather Necessary Documents for Vehicle Registration

cars

Before you start the registration process, make sure to gather all the essential documents required by the California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V). One crucial piece of paper is the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) verification report. You can obtain this through a mobile vin inspection or by visiting an authorized service center. The VIN is a unique code that identifies your vehicle’s make, model, and year, ensuring accurate registration.

Additionally, you’ll need to provide proof of ownership, typically a title document, as well as valid identification like a driver’s license. Insurance paperwork is also essential, especially if you’re financing your car purchase. By having these documents prepared, you’ll streamline the registration process, making it faster and less stressful at the DMV.
